Saar (Essence)

Ananta clarifies that true freedom is the openness to all states, revealing a deeper, unchanging peace of awareness that remains untouched by external noise or phenomenal activity.

Freedom is the allowing of all states to come and go without being constricted.
True peace is your nature as awareness, untouched by any phenomenal activity or noise.
You cannot stop being, and this peace is the nature of your being itself.

Seeker

There is a peace as long as I am sitting silently. As soon as I am moving and getting active again, the peace is not there anymore.

Ananta

Your freedom is not dependent on which state is showing up. Don't confuse freedom to be some sleep. Whatever the state means, you don't... it is the allowing of all states to come and go. That way you are not constricted, you're not closed. Just be completely open and then you will find that there is a deeper peace. This deeper peace means that you as awareness are not touched by any of this. So the phenomenology is the feeling of peace and quiet, then that can go into noise and activity. If the true peace is your peace of being, untouched by any of this, therefore 'peace' sometimes also can be a confusing word because when the Satguru talks about this peace, this unchanging, talking about the peace of awareness, untouched, unmoved. But that does not mean that states like that are not... these times which are full of activity and noise and where this quietness and peace is there phenomenally, but internally inside as awareness, the thing is moved. This is the real peace. And as more and more you are now marinating in your true Self, you will see that this peace is not changing. The phenomenal peace can come and go.
